Odd Mishap Injures Three On Board Flight Departing from Bradley

Two passengers and a flight attendant sustained injuries in a freak accident as a plane departed from Windsor Locks.

WINDSOR LOCKS, CT - Two passengers and a flight attendant were injured Thursday morning when a beverage cart broke free aboard an American Airlines plane departing from Bradley International Airport.

The cart broke loose during takeoff, injuring the three, and was immediately secured. The injured persons sought medical treatment upon arrival in Charlotte, N.C., according to the airlines.

In an email to Patch, American Airlines spokesman Ross Feinstein wrote, "During takeoff for American Airlines flight 1941 from Hartford Bradley Airport to Charlotte Douglas International Airport (CLT), a beverage cart came loose. The cart was secured and the flight continued, landing without incident at CLT. Our Care Team is assisting two passengers and one flight attendant who requested medical evaluation when they arrived in CLT."
